ABB 1MYN569697 - G is a trip circuit monitoring relay, which belongs to the TCS type monitoring relay. Its relevant information is as follows:


Functional features

Continuous monitoring: It can continuously monitor the circuit breaker trip circuit, which is not affected by the circuit breaker position. It can promptly detect problems such as loss of auxiliary power supply, fault of trip coil or its wire, fault of circuit breaker auxiliary contact and fault of monitoring relay itself, and issue an alarm.

Fault indication: Under normal circumstances, the indicator LED is green and the output relay is in the pickup state. If a fault occurs, the monitoring relay will operate (fall) after a delay of 0.6 seconds, and the LED indicator will turn red, clearly indicating the fault state.

Electrical isolation: There is electrical isolation between the auxiliary power supply and the monitoring circuit, which can enhance the safety and stability of the system and avoid mutual interference.

Adapt to a variety of circuits: Based on the principle of low-level (about 3mA) current injection, it can be used for sensitive or high-resistance circuits, and the burden on the auxiliary source is extremely low. It can work stably in circuits with a variety of different characteristics. At the same time, it has a complete rated AC/DC voltage range, including 24V DC, 30V DC, 48V DC, 100-125V AC/DC, 220-250V AC/DC, etc., which can be adapted to different power systems.

Delayed operation: With delayed operation function, it can avoid false operation caused by stray signals during the operation of the circuit breaker, and improve the accuracy and reliability of monitoring.

Contact configuration: 1NO (normally open) + 1NC (normally closed) + 2C/O (conversion contact), this configuration can meet the connection requirements of various control circuits, and can flexibly realize connection with different devices or circuits to complete various control and signal transmission tasks.
